The role of institutions of higher education in societal development is becoming increasing significant. In recent years, higher education has isolated itself from the society and there is a need to re-establish and strengthen higher education’s close linkages with the society. How can Universities foster social responsibility and engage in community outreach programmes. Sharing some working examples would also be a useful input.

We all are aware of bad quality education at primary level, particularly in the schools run by government machinery. We have some social schemes in the universities like NSS and military training by NCC. In the similar line GOI can create NES (National Education Service) or some thing like that, where student from Universities, IIT, NIT etc can take the teaching responsibilities, the way they take NSS or NCC. They can provide a tutorial like class in the evening or morning.

I believe compartmentalizing higher education into science and humanities streams has led to a vast majority of educated youth being alienated from social issues. Promoting incorporation of social sciences like history and sociology along with technical subjects at university level for engineering and medicine fields will go a long way in developing educated youth more aware of the needs of our society.
